Then, what is the anode in a fuel cell?
The anode, the negative post of the fuel cell, has several jobs. It conducts the electrons that are freed from the hydrogen molecules so that they can be used in an external circuit. It has channels etched into it that disperse the hydrogen gas equally over the surface of the catalyst.
Additionally, what is a PEM fuel cell made of? PEMFC. The proton exchange membrane fuel cell (PEMFC) uses a water-based, acidic polymer membrane as its electrolyte, with platinum-based electrodes.
Moreover, what are the main parts of a fuel cell?
There are many types of fuel cells, but they all consist of an anode, a cathode, and an electrolyte that allows ions, often positively charged hydrogen ions (protons), to move between the two sides of the fuel cell.
What are fuel cells used for?
Fuel cells can be used in a wide range of applications, including transportation, material handling and stationary, portable, and emergency backup power. Hydrogen can be used in fuel cells to generate power using a chemical reaction rather than combustion, producing only water and heat as byproducts.
What are the disadvantages of fuel cells?
Disadvantages:- Expensive to manufacture due the high cost of catalysts (platinum)
- Lack of infrastructure to support the distribution of hydrogen.
- A lot of the currently available fuel cell technology is in the prototype stage and not yet validated.
- Hydrogen is expensive to produce and not widely available.

The biggest difference between the two is that a battery stores energy, while a fuel cell generates energy by converting available fuel. A fuel cell can have a battery as a system component to store the electricity it's generating.What are the four main parts of a Pemfc?
